I was recently in my small hometown of Ruston, Louisiana, and thought to stop by the Military Museum and photograph something that caught my eye when I was creating images for the article, No Lifeguards.

I noticed there was a U.S. Mailbox dedicated to returning used American Flags. I didn’t know there were mailboxes out there dedicated to flag disposal.
